为了账号安全,请及时绑定邮箱和手机立即绑定

请问我哪里错了,输出空白,,数据库里面有数据

<?php

//链接数据库

$host = '172.0.0.1';//地址

$host_database = 'test1';

$link = mysqli_connect($host,$host_database);

mysqli_select_db($link,"test1");//选择数据库

mysqli_query($link,"set name 'utf8'");


//在这里获取一行数据

$sql = "select * from test1_1";

$result = mysqli_query($link,$sql);

$row = mysqli_fetch_array($result);


echo '<pre>';

print_r($row);

echo '</pre>';

echo 123;


正在回答

4 回答

//你用的是mysqli链接数据库
<?php
//链接数据库
$host = '127.0.0.1';//地址
$host_database = 'test1';
$user = '';
$psw = '';
$link = mysqli_connect($host,$user,$psw,$host_database);
mysqli_select_db($link,"test1");//选择数据库
mysqli_query($link,"set name 'utf8'");

//在这里获取一行数据
$sql = "select * from test1_1";
$result = mysqli_query($link,$sql);
$row = mysqli_fetch_array($result);

echo '<pre>';
print_r($row);
echo '</pre>';

你试试这样

0 回复 有任何疑惑可以回复我~
#1

醉大侠

我写错了一行,就是那行选择数据库的你删了。
2016-03-11 回复 有任何疑惑可以回复我~
#2

qq__2277 提问者

非常感谢!
2016-03-13 回复 有任何疑惑可以回复我~

本地地址错了 应该是127.0.0.1或者localhost

0 回复 有任何疑惑可以回复我~

我的数据库没有账号密码啊.....就是不确定连没连上......$link写了没事吧...

0 回复 有任何疑惑可以回复我~

数据库用户名密码都没写,你确定连上数据库啦,还有是set names,很多$link不用写

0 回复 有任何疑惑可以回复我~
#1

qq__2277 提问者

我的数据库没有账号密码啊.....就是不确定连没连上......$link写了没事吧...
2016-02-25 回复 有任何疑惑可以回复我~

举报

0/150
提交
取消
PHP进阶篇
  • 参与学习       181826    人
  • 解答问题       2577    个

轻松学习PHP中级课程,进行全面了解,用PHP快速开发网站程序

进入课程

请问我哪里错了,输出空白,,数据库里面有数据

我要回答 关注问题
意见反馈 帮助中心 APP下载
官方微信